The Arizona Cardinals placed cornerback Byron Murphy Jr. on injured reserve, ending his season with three games remaining, the team announced Saturday.

Arizona signed defensive lineman Michael Dogbe to the active roster from the practice squad to replace Murphy Jr. on the 53-man team. Cornerback Nate Hairston and kick returner Pharoh Cooper were elevated from the practice squad for Sunday’s game against the Tampa Bay Buccaneers.

Murphy Jr. has not played since Week 9 due to a back issue.

The 2019 second-round pick missed one defensive snap throughout the first nine games of the season. He had one of the highlights of a down 2022 campaign for the Cardinals, as he returned a fumble for the game-winning touchdown in overtime against the Raiders in Week 2.

Murphy Jr. is an unrestricted free agent after the season.

Hairston, Marco Wilson, Christian Matthew and Jace Whittaker will make up Arizona’s cornerback corps this week, and Antonio Hamilton is questionable (back).

Arizona’s injured reserve now sits at 13 players, including quarterback Kyler Murray and center Rodney Hudson.

Dobge returns to the active roster after he was released on Nov. 10. He has played in 10 games this season.
